🏔️ Jammu and Kashmir
The Jammu and Kashmir government has declared a two-week summer vacation for all government and recognised private schools up to the Higher Secondary level across the Kashmir Valley.
- 📅 Holiday Period: July 6 to July 19, 2026
- 🌡️ Reason: Severe heatwave conditions affecting the region.
Schools are expected to reopen after the summer vacation unless fresh orders are issued.
🌧️ Maharashtra
Due to continuous heavy rainfall, district administrations in Palghar and Raigad declared a school holiday on July 2.
The holiday applied to:
- ✅ Primary Schools
- ✅ Secondary Schools
- ✅ Higher Secondary Schools
Teaching and non-teaching staff were directed to remain available for official duties if required.
Authorities may announce additional holidays depending on the weather situation.
🏫 West Bengal
The West Bengal Government has declared July 6, 2026, as a public holiday to mark the 125th birth anniversary of Syama Prasad Mukherjee.
🏖️ The holiday applies to:
- Schools
- Colleges
- Government Offices
Private institutions may follow separate notifications.
📅 July School Holidays 2026: State-Wise Holiday List
| 📅 Date | 🎉 Holiday | 📍 States |
|---|---|---|
| July 5, 12, 19 & 26 | Sundays | All States & Union Territories |
| July 16 | Rath Yatra | Odisha, West Bengal, Manipur and other observing states |
| July 16 | Harela | Uttarakhand (subject to government notification) |
| July 29 | Guru Purnima | Uttar Pradesh, Bihar, Gujarat, Rajasthan, Madhya Pradesh, Maharashtra, Chhattisgarh, Uttarakhand, Himachal Pradesh, Jharkhand and other notified states |
| July 31 | Shaheed Udham Singh Martyrdom Day | Punjab |

🚩 Odisha
Schools across Odisha are expected to remain closed on July 16 for Rath Yatra, subject to district administration notifications.
Since the festival attracts lakhs of devotees every year, local authorities may announce additional restrictions or holidays in affected districts.
